Output 387594597f73eca7a116d196429468a28c411f6a724a4a01ddc6fcc2f754bd0e:1

value
3090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 693afece305df438f019912792e52660e00acae3 OP_EQUAL
address
3BHRYkfLxpc1uz32AYMpxnCXbNs7eUB93J
transaction
387594597f73eca7a116d196429468a28c411f6a724a4a01ddc6fcc2f754bd0e
spent
true